1. Street Profits Get The Smoke

After all the buildup, you couldn’t have the Street Profits come out and lose in the main event, could you?

The duo has been de facto hosts of Raw for a few months now, but they finally made their in-ring debut Monday against The OC, and they didn’t come alone. After watching numerous teams fall to the numbers game, they enlisted the help of Kevin Owens, who hit a Stunner on AJ Styles to even the odds, allowing Montez Ford to nail a frogsplash for the win.

The big question for the Profits was whether their gimmick would translate in a big arena – it’s worked really well at the much smaller Full Sail. Ford and Angelo Dawkins danced through the crowd, hyping them up on the way to the ring, which did the trick. The match itself wasn’t that great, but the right team won, so that’s a positive step.

Memo to WWE: If you want to get them really over, distribute red Solo cups to fans facing the camera before the Street Profits come out so they can toast along with Ford.
